Manufacturing Processes for Dissolvable Microneedle Patches
Dissolvable microneedle patches are emerging as a promising platform for transdermal drug delivery. These patches consist numerous microscopic needles fabricated from absorbable materials that dissolve upon insertion with the skin.
The fabrication of these patches involves a multifaceted process that involves precise regulation over various factors. Commonly utilized manufacturing strategies include:
* **Microfabrication:** This technique utilizes lithography or other micro-scale patterning processes to create the microneedles.
* **3D Printing:** Additive building methods can be used to build microneedle arrays with specific geometries.
* **Electrospinning:** This technique involves the creation of nanofibers, which can be assembled into microneedle structures.
The selection of manufacturing strategy depends on factors such as extent, desired needle geometry, and material properties.

Developing Dissolving Microneedle Patches for Targeted and Controlled Drug Release
Dissolving microneedle patches represent a novel approach for targeted and controlled drug delivery. These patches, typically made of hydrogel materials, are equipped with microscopic needles that dissolve quickly upon application with the skin. The probes traverse the stratum corneum, the outermost layer of the skin, delivering medications directly to the underlying tissue. This approach offers several advantages over traditional drug delivery systems, including enhanced efficacy, reduced complications, and improved patient compliance.
Furthermore, dissolving microneedle patches can be engineered to release drugs in a regulated manner. This specificity in drug delivery allows for optimized therapeutic outcomes and decreased the risk of adverse consequences. Ongoing research is focused on broadening the applications of dissolving microneedle patches for a wide range selection of diseases, including chronic conditions.
